Biography of Pete Sampras
Pete Sampras, born on August 12, 1971, in Potomac, Maryland, USA, is widely regarded as one of the greatest tennis players of all time. His journey from a young boy fascinated by tennis to a world-renowned champion is nothing short of inspirational. Below is a summary of his key personal and professional details.
Personal Data
Full Name | Petros "Pete" Sampras |
---|---|
Date of Birth | August 12, 1971 |
Place of Birth | Potomac, Maryland, USA |
Height | 6 ft 1 in (1.85 m) |
Playing Style | Serve and Volley |
Major Titles | 14 Grand Slam Titles |

Career Highlights: Pete Sampras' Golden Era
Pete Sampras' career spanned over two decades, during which he achieved numerous milestones and redefined the game of tennis. His dominance on the court was evident from the early years of his professional career. Here are some of his most notable achievements:
- 14 Grand Slam Titles, including a record-breaking 7 Wimbledon Championships.
- Ranked World No. 1 for a record 286 weeks.
- Won six ATP Finals titles, showcasing his consistency and excellence.

Breaking Records: Pete Sampras' Achievements
Pete Sampras' career is filled with records that highlight his dominance in the world of tennis. His achievements not only reflect his skill but also his longevity and consistency as a player. Some of his most notable records include:

- Most Wimbledon Titles (7).
- Longest tenure as World No. 1 (286 weeks).
- Most consecutive year-end World No. 1 rankings (6 years).
These records underscore Sampras' status as one of the greatest players in tennis history.

Life After Retirement
After retiring from professional tennis in 2002, Pete Sampras continued to remain active in the sport. He participated in exhibition matches and charity events, using his platform to give back to the community. His post-retirement life reflects his commitment to tennis and his desire to stay connected to the sport he loves.
